Output 1c85268040e454d484356d980766b4daed404124c68dc2588484a7cafa033a63:0

value
2566145
script pubkey
OP_0 OP_PUSHBYTES_20 c8be51adce90b5acfd092764bd2ef717191cbcab
address
bc1qezl9rtwwjz66elgfyajt6thhzuv3e09tsjypld
transaction
1c85268040e454d484356d980766b4daed404124c68dc2588484a7cafa033a63
confirmations
341102
spent
true